14020636
0xe598c74723735fb9eef8b6dedb8adf480c043b2386b932f3a2c64a98b05ffd10
Transactions408
Height14020636
Confirmations5405827
Timestamp879 days 8 hours ago
Size (bytes)152033
Version
Merkle Root
Nonce0x0e04d8d8047535db
Bits
Difficulty0x2ab91505e1c863

Transactions

ERC20 Token Transfers